Job Summary
The Claims Adjuster actively adjusts claims while ensuring that business development opportunities are maximized. This involves marketing and follow-up of opportunities in a timely manner. To succeed in this role, the ideal candidate should have background/experience in Property.
Key Responsibilities
Prompt contact and follow up with policy holders and claimants.
Investigate the cause and report to clients with solid recommendations.
Using supplied technology (e.g., Docusketch.), scope and establish quantum of damages.
Identify exposures, recommend reserves, recommend investigation required for exposure, prepare action plans, and negotiate fair and satisfactory settlements.
Throughout the claims process, provide high level of customer service to clients and the insured.
Participate and share ownership and responsibility for afterhours customer service requirements when required
Perform duties assigned to him/her in compliance with established work standards, policies and procedures
Qualifications and Experience:
Completion of high school education; University degree or post-secondary education related to insurance will be given preference.
Proficient in use of Microsoft Office Products (Outlook, Word, Excel, OneDrive).
At least 3 years' relevant experience in claims adjusting
Ongoing commitment to education and learning; adjuster’s license, or currently pursuing CIP designation
Effective analytical skills, including identification of cause-and-effect dynamics
Able to draw valid conclusions and effectively communicate them.
Ability to interpret complex documents of a legal nature, perform and understand advanced numerical calculations including analysis of comparative information.
Excellent communication skills, including listening, interviewing, negotiating, must be able to flex style appropriate to audience
Proactive and positive approach to customer service ensuring that all inquiries are effectively dealt with in a timely manner.
Strong interpersonal skills allowing you to effectively deal with conflict and difficult situations.
